Here is a list of most important and must-have information in order to file your form 2290

1. Business Name
2. Business Address
3. EIN (Employer Identification Number) a unique 9 digit number assigned by the IRS
4. VIN (Vehicle Information Number) - It is a 17 character alfa-numeric
5. The gross weight of the vehicle

Filling Form 2290 with utmost caution is highly recommended as most of the return rejections by the IRS occur due to incomplete information and/or information mismatch!
What are the commonly occurred mistakes and how to avoid them?
Below are some of the most commonly occurring errors. Keeping them in mind will help one to avoid repeating these mistakes

Error 1 - EIN Mismatch

The most commonly occurred mismatch is the EIN and the Business Name. Make sure your Business Name, Business Address, and the EIN Number match

Where to find this information?

You can find the Business Name, Business Address, and EIN on the SS-4 issued by the IRS. If you don’t know how does an SS-4 copy looks like, go through the video to find the example.

Please note, EIN expands as Employer Identification Number. It is a unique 9 digit number not to be confused with your Social Security Number.

Error 2 - Incorrect VIN

VIN stands for Vehicle Identification Number. It is a 17 character alpha-numeric series which is unique to every vehicle.

Where to find this information?
VIN can be found on the vehicle registration document, near the windshield of your truck, or near the engine.

Error 3 - Incorrect Gross Weight
The gross weight of your truck is extremely important. Make sure to mention the total capacity weight of the vehicle.

Where to find this information?
Gross weight can be found on the vehicle purchase document, vehicle registration copy, or the left door jamb near the driver’s seat.

How to file Form 2290 online?
You can do it in 5 simple steps mentioned below:

1. Register yourself
2. Fill in ‘Business’ details
3. Select the ‘Tax Period’ & ‘First Used Month’ of your vehicle
4. Enter your vehicle information
5. Make the payment
